Elevate your career by becoming a Visual Language Interpreter with School District 72 in Campbell River. This essential role involves interpreting ASL for deaf and hard of hearing students alongside dedicated educational teams.
In this permanent position, you'll support students' learning experiences by interpreting classroom lessons, activities, and fostering communication between students and staff. You'll play a vital role in implementing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) while collaborating closely with teachers and support staff.
Key Responsibilities:
• Provide ASL interpretation for educational content
• Facilitate communication during classes and school activities
• Adapt signing techniques to meet student requirements
• Ensure confidentiality of sensitive information
• Attend staff meetings and undertake assigned responsibilities
Requirements:
• Completed a two-year ASL Interpretation post-secondary program
• At least one year of relevant experience
• Demonstrated ASL fluency (Level 4 or higher)
• Class 5 BC Driver's License required
• Up-to-date Criminal Record Check every five years
